Senior Software Engineer For Ceph

Senior Software Engineer For Ceph
Empresa:

Ibm Careers


Detalles de la oferta

IBM's Ceph[1] Engineering organization is looking for a Senior Software Engineer to join the CephFS team. In this role you will collaborate with our worldwide Ceph engineering team to develop and enhance CephFS[2], the file system component of the Ceph software-defined distributed storage system. You will design and implement new capabilities and features to enable new use cases while improving scalability, performance and efficiency. You will participate in a vibrant and active open source community[3] to deliver enterprise-quality software.

CephFS comprises a wide-ranging software suite including Linux kernel and userspace clients, a clustered userspace metadata server, and a messaging layer for storing data with Ceph's native object store ("RADOS"), in addition to higher-level APIs for integrating with other systems (OpenStack, OpenShift, an NFS-Ganesha cluster, Samba, etc). As a member of the CephFS engineering team, you will have the opportunity to learn and work in many of these areas according to your experience and technical background. Candidates will be excited to develop new distributed algorithms to build out end-user features of the filesystem, such as instant cloning, file overlays, and coherent snapshots across multiple clients with a coherent distributed cache.

You will work remotely with a worldwide team so communication is key. You will collaborate with others using modern open source tools including git (and GitHub), Jenkins, Redmine, and community-developed testing and validation tools.
Roles and Responsibilities of a Senior Software Engineer in IBM's Ceph Engineering Organization:
Work closely with the global Ceph open-source, multi-company engineering team to develop and enhance CephFS, the file system component of the Ceph software-defined distributed storage system. You will collaborate with other developers and users by attending online meetings, participating in email lists and online chat rooms, preparing written documentation, and giving presentations about your work. You will be expected to work proactively with other team members and the community to develop your own knowledge, and to be ready to mentor new contributors as you develop expertise.

Contribute to the development of CephFS by designing and implementing new functionalities that enable innovative use cases. This includes designing new distributed algorithms, implementing them across clients and servers, and writing automated test cases to demonstrate they work. You will also identify and fix bugs and propose performance enhancements. This will involve work across our C++-language Metadata Server cluster and userspace clients, our Linux in-kernel client (which you may either develop on your own, or arrange with our kernel maintainers), and our messaging layer for storing data within Ceph's "RADOS" distributed object store.
[1]:
https://ceph.io/en/news/publications/
,
https://www.youtube.com/c/Cephstorage
[2: ]
https://docs.ceph.com/en/quincy/cephfs/
,
https://youtu.be/cNAxNSzZqzo?t=1311
[3]:
https://github.com/ceph/ceph
,
https://tracker.ceph.com/projects/cephfs


Fuente: Brassring

Requisitos

Senior Software Engineer For Ceph
Empresa:

Ibm Careers


Ingeniero Civil O Construcción

Graduado de Licenciatura en Ingeniería Civil o Construcción. - Experiência mínima de 2 años. - Capacidad de supervisión de obra, control de avance y presupue...


Desde Grupo Selvatura - San José

Publicado a month ago

Ingeniero Back End

Descripción del Puesto Como ingeniero senior de desarrollo frontend, serás responsable de diseñar, desarrollar y mantener interfaces frontend de alta calida...


Desde Moon Hi - San José

Publicado a month ago

Auxiliar Vindi Coronado

Cumplir con las diferentes etapas del proceso productivo para la elaboración de las recetas de los distintos panes, postres y repostería. También debe colabo...


Desde Auto Mercado - San José

Publicado a month ago

Intermediate Engineer I

**DUTIES AND RESPONSIBILITIES**: - Read and interpret process drawings (PFD, P&ID). - Perform and Lead engineering activities related to Distributed Control...


Desde Emerson - San José

Publicado a month ago

Built at: 2024-09-29T02:18:18.594Z